First Alert Weather Day: Snow Expected Across Southcentral Alaska Thursday

The Weather Team at Alaska's Weather Source has declared a First Alert Weather Day for Thursday as snow is expected to impact southcentral Alaska.

Snowfall Forecast

An area of low pressure in the Gulf of Alaska is moving moisture into the region, triggering a November snowfall. Snow will begin around midday and continue into the evening.

Storm Duration and Impact

The snowstorm is expected to mostly clear by Friday, marking a brief but notable weather event for the region.
